ELEGY FOR FIFTY CENTS
about those unworn baby shoes,
don't leap to tragedy.
everyone knows babies hate things on their feet.
they kick them off.
frugal parents hock them at a yard sale.
this is not news, no
know:
even at the bottom of an iceberg
hope floats

ALLISON WHITTENBERG is an award winning novelist and playwright. Her poetry has appeared in Columbia Review, Feminist Studies, J Journal, and New Orleans Review. Whittenberg is a ten-time Pushcart Prize nominee. They Were Horrible Cooks is her collection of poetry. Killing the Father of Our Country is her latest novel.
